Meaning of “Follow”

Follow means to go or come after (a person or thing); to move behind; to obey (a rule or instruction); or, to understand (an explanation or logical connection).

We use it for movement (follow the path), time (Spring follows Winter), rules (follow the rules), or understanding (I don’t follow your logic).

Synonyms for “Follow”

Here are some common ways to say follow:

  • Pursue: To go after in an effort to catch or achieve. A strong alternative for actively chasing a goal.
  • Succeed: To come next in order after (someone or something). Used specifically when referring to sequence or succession.
  • Obey: To comply with the command, direction, or request of (someone or something). Used when emphasizing adherence to rules.
  • Observe: To conform to (a law or custom); to follow. A formal alternative for obeying rules or customs.
  • Comprehend: To grasp mentally; understand. Used when the meaning is intellectual understanding.

Example Sentences

  • The detective decided to pursue the suspect down the alley.
  • King George VI succeeded his brother to the throne in 1936.
  • All employees must obey the new safety regulations immediately.
  • We must observe the local customs when visiting the village.
  • I am not sure I comprehend the complexity of the argument you are making.

Common Mistakes to Avoid

Don’t say: She followed after him to the store. (The word follow already means go after.)

Do say: She followed him to the store. (Keep it concise.)
